Finance Review Summary — Ashgrove Depot Lease

Quick recap for the sales leads: we've renegotiated the Ashgrove depot lease down roughly 15%, swapping a ten-year term for six plus a break. Frees up budget that was squeezing regional travel and demo stock. Nothing changes day-to-day until January. Worth knowing the bigger picture, though, so here's the plan context below.

board note of yadup-fajef: Druiusox Holdings is in early talks to buy Norwynek Systems for about $186.0 million. The Kaseth launch date is June 24, and nothing goes to the press before then. Legal wants the Quenethek Group term sheet withdrawn before November 27.

### Background

The Tarnwell gateway was exhausting file descriptors roughly every nine days. We traced it to response bodies left open on early-return error paths, plus a watchdog that masked the leak by restarting workers. This doc covers the detection approach: periodic descriptor census, leak-rate alerting, and forced cleanup. The monitoring thresholds we use are below.

tuning table, yajog-yahof:
BUDGETS = {
    "lamvan": 303,
    "wenox": 460,
    "fenvan": 525,
}

**Ticket QRM-482: Config drift between staging and prod queue workers**

As part of replacing our homegrown job queue with Conveyor, we found that staging and prod workers diverged over several months of manual edits. Plugin authors: your handlers will be migrated automatically, but retry semantics now come from central config, not per-plugin overrides. Overrides baked into plugin manifests will be ignored after the cutover on the Velmont cluster. For reference, the canonical worker configuration going forward is listed below.

config for kafof-bawef:
holath:
  log_level: debug
  metrics_host: metrics.holath.qorvelsys.internal
  pin: 2191
  pool_size: 32